I saw many topics covering the CV joint replacement but in none of them I'm reading my difficulties.
I would like you have a look on my picture As you notice there is a cyrclip ... I'm trying to enlarge it and at the same time try to pull the joint, but it wont move at all! Moreover I have the impression that the cyrclip does not stop the joint to move outwards (in the direction of the wheel I mean) I shall I proceed? |

you just snatch it off neuronet, a sharp tap with a copper hammer, or i usually clamp the shaft and knock the shaft inwards (then undo the hubnut)

frank2 it's exactly as you told me!
somehow I managed to fix the axis with the car and a single hammer hit was enough to extract the joint! It was really useless any attempt I did before trying to hammer with one hand and keep the axis fixed with the second hand. the pic shows what I used to fix the axis with the car many many thanks!!! |
